City commission approves search agreement to help recruit Utility Director candidates

The Madison City Commission has approved an agreement with a search organization to help find candidates for the city’s Utility Director position.  During their meeting Monday, commissioners approved a contingency search agreement with gpac, LLC.  City Administrator Jameson Berreth said that gpac can help with recruiting candidates for the vacant Utility Director position.

Berreth said that the city has been advertising for the position for several months but has not been successful in finding the right person for the job.  He said that the money the city has saved from not having someone in the position could be used to pay for the service.  Berreth said that gpac has around four-thousand recruiters around the country to help in the search for candidates.
